The work by Blinkink features four films to announce the luxury brand’s Winter 2025 Collection and runway show at London Fashion Week.
In a crafty spot for the fashion brand's Winter 2025 collection at London Fashion Week, Blinkink's Daniel Quirke and a nifty sewing machine take us on a tour of the city in 120 stiched frames.
The production studio has embroidered 120 stitched frames to bring Burberry’s iconic knight logo to life for a journey across London to kick start the fashion house’s Winter 2025 show.
